We were feeling good and acclimatizing well in Khote so we decided to gain some more elevation and move closer to Mera Peak itself. This morning, we left Khote and trekked up the valley to Thagnak. The weather was cool and sunny and we all enjoyed the walk up the wild valley, strewn with boulders from the long-ago flood. Lots of good conversation and snappy reparteé.
We saw a small avalanche come off the ridge on the far side of the valley. We will send photos from our day as soon as technology permits.
We’ll spend two nights here in Thagnak, at about 13,700 feet, and acclimatize some more.
